Labour Peer and former Trade Commissioner in Europe, Peter Mandelson, has joined anti-EU Tories stance against May. He doesn't agree with them on Brexit it seems but he does agree that her White Paper for Brexit is that bad they need to join forces to defeat it, such is the scale of rejection she's facing.
Meanwhile...
Labour support amongst voters is now above that of the Tories according to a new poll. The quick to jump minds out there may think that it's because public opinion is moving against the Tories and their Brexit strategy but it turns out they'd only be half right. The Tories are losing voter support... but it's all going towards reviving the pulse of UKIP instead with Labour having actually received no uplift. It seems that by aiming for soft Brexit, Teresa May is recreating the the same support base that caused the Referendum in the first place with little momentum to actually suggest the often mentioned swing in favour of Remain Camp actually exists, more that the nation remains evenly split on the majority of the matter.Last edited by Neon Ignition; 14-07-2018, 22:00.
